Who Is Responsible For Software Program High Quality?

Everything contains the application features, design, functionalities, scalability, reliability, effectivity, usability, and so on. to check whether the application will meet the standard benchmarks or not. By testing earlier, will be capable of detect and solve defects rather than having to resolve them on the finish of the method. The software program bugs recognized, the longer and more expensive they’re to repair. Involved testers in the course of the necessities and design to allow them to assist formulate a extra useful framework. More than 70 {0b3db76f39496ef9bed68a2f117e2160e742e10063d5d376aaf9aa586bcd8ff6} of points in a stay surroundings traced back to poor circumstances. Predictability decreases as re-work grows, and decrease quality product will increase.

Why Is Software Development Completely Different?

This attribute is indicative as to whether an software will execute the tasks it is assigned to perform. Availability additionally consists of sure concepts that relate to software program safety, efficiency, integrity, reliability, dependability, and confidentiality. In addition, top-notch availability signifies that a software-driven system will restore any working faults so that service outage durations wouldn’t exceed a particular time worth.

High scores in Software Quality Attributes allow software architects to ensure that a software program application will carry out as the specifications supplied by the client. Visual Testing This form of testing is crucial for companies which are depending on software program to deliver the intended service and efficiency outcomes for his or her customers. ELearning Testing Codoid’s Elearning utility testing services guarantee the standard of your interactive e-studying purposes, studying & content material management system. It is estimated that for 2018 worldwide person spending on software would be the equivalent of 288.eight billion US dollars, and the market progress fee is extremely quick. Regardless, customers are usually dissatisfied with the situation of laptop programs.

High Quality Engineering Mindset Across Everybody

software quality

Presentation And Advocacy Of Sqa Points To Executive Management

To get an perception into why that is happening and the way to change it, you must first construct an understanding of the principles behind software quality. Nowadays, we’re adopting an agile improvement method for sooner high quality software releases. Hence, it becomes highly essential for the QA teams to make sure the development efforts not dumped. The precept of “Test Early Test Often” will help the QA teams to find the bugs early and infrequently to substantiate continuous delivery. Requirements gathering is an essential part of the development cycle as well as quality assurance.